Boom Boom Rocket (2007)

69%

Boom Boom Rocket is a fast-paced rhythm game developed for Xbox Live Arcade. Players must time their explosions to the beat of ten original tracks created by Ian Livingstone while travelling through a 3D cityscape, with more spectacular fireworks effects as they better match the timing of each explosion. The game features three modes - Normal, Speed and Multiplayer Head-to-Head - each song being choreographed at varying skill levels so that everyone can join in on the fun. Players can unlock new firework designs by mastering each track as well as fill up bonus meters to activate psychedelic bonus modes for extra points. Additionally, players can connect online and compare their scores with other players on leaderboards.

Just Shapes & Beats (2018)

Just Shapes & Beats is a chaotic co-op musical bullet-hell game from the developers of Berzerk. The game revolves around three simple concepts: avoid shapes, move to the beats and die (repeatedly). Players can play alone or with up to four players, both locally and online, through Story Mode or Challenge Runs. It features 35 handcrafted stages with licensed tracks from over 20 chiptune and EDM artists as well as Party Mode for social gatherings. There are also Casual mode in Story Mode and Playlist for practice runs.

Beat Saber (2019)

Beat Saber is a virtual reality rhythm game that combines the thrill of slashing beats with perfectly handcrafted music. Players must use their dual lightsabers to slash and cut blocks that are in sync with the beat of the song, while also avoiding obstacles such as bombs or walls. The goal is to hit as many blocks as possible while maintaining accuracy and precision in order to achieve a high score at the end of each level. Beat Saber offers an immersive experience for players who enjoy rhythm games, and its unique mechanics make it stand out from other VR titles.
